Recognition for reduction in motorcycle accidents across Derbyshire
Derbyshire County Council has been awarded a Green Flag by the Comprehensive Area Assessment (CAA) for its outstanding work for reducing motorcycle accidents in the county. In 2007, a third of all road users ‘Killed and Seriously Injured' (KSI) in Derbyshire were motorcyclists; following a focus on prioritising motorcycle accidents through ‘operation-focused' activity, in 2008 this figure was reduced by 32% to 127.

Nottingham City: Officially the Best Public Transport in the Country

EM IEP CS24

01 Mar 2010

An independent MORI survey reported user satisfaction figures of 76.9% (over 90% for trams) for public transport in Nottingham making it the joint highest in the country. This, combined with the sustained increase in use of public transport in the city, 7% since 2004 excluding concessions, has earned Nottingham City Council a Comprehensive Area Assessment (CAA) Green Flag.
